Real-World K-Pop Crypto Innovations
While NCT 127 explores this space cautiously, other pioneers demonstrate its potential:
- BTS’ partnership with Dunamu for NFT trading cards
- Super Junior’s ‘Beyond LIVE’ virtual concert platform
- K-pop DAOs (Decentralized Autonomous Organizations) funding fan projects
- SM Entertainment’s ‘SMCU’ metaverse project roadmap
How to Safely Engage with K-Pop Crypto
Before diving into NCT 127-related crypto:
- Verify official announcements – avoid unauthorized token offerings
- Use regulated exchanges like Coinbase or Upbit
- Secure assets in hardware wallets (e.g., Ledger)
- Allocate only disposable income – crypto remains volatile

FAQ: Crypto and NCT 127 Explained
Q: Does NCT 127 have an official cryptocurrency?
A: Not currently. Any “NCT coin” promotions are unauthorized.
Q: How could NFTs benefit K-pop fans?
A: NFTs provide verifiable ownership of digital collectibles, exclusive content, and unique fan experiences.
Q: What crypto platforms support K-pop projects?
A: Klaytn (backed by Kakao) and Upbit Exchange lead Korea’s entertainment blockchain initiatives.
Q: Are SM Entertainment NFTs a good investment?
A: Treat them as collectibles, not investments. Their value depends on fan demand, not financial fundamentals.
